B26-0181: Short-Term Disability Insurance Benefit Protection Clarification Amendment Act of 2025
Legislative Summary
As introduced, Bill 26-181 would prohibit private disability insurance providers from reducing short-term disability benefits based on actual or estimated paid leave benefits an eligible individual may be entitled to from the District, regardless of the jurisdiction in which the insurance policy was issued. It would also make offsetting or reducing benefits under a short-term disability insurance policy based on estimated or actual benefits received under the Universal Paid Leave Amendment Act of 2016 enforceable under the law.
